A local authority is seeking an experienced Placement Officer to join its Fostering Service on an initial 3-month contract. This fast-paced role requires excellent coordination skills to support the effective placement of children and young people into foster care.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Identifying and securing foster placements
  • Working closely with social workers
  • Maintaining compliance with internal standards

Ideal candidates will have previous experience in children's services, knowledge of fostering, and strong organizational skills. The position is based in Sutton, United Kingdom.

✨Showcase Your Coordination Skills

Since this role requires excellent coordination skills, be prepared to discuss specific examples from your past experience where you've successfully managed multiple tasks or projects.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and highlight your organisational prowess.

✨Build Rapport with Interviewers

Remember, interviews are a two-way street! Take the time to connect with your interviewers by asking insightful questions about the team and the challenges they face.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the role is the right fit for you.

✨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ving abilities in real-life situations. Think about potential challenges you might face in the role and how you would handle them. Practising these scenarios can help you feel more confident and articulate during the interview.
